Default 1999 honda accord oil leak of half litre every 200-300 miles?

I have a 1999 honda accord 2L vtec F20B engine with 90000 miles and I seem to have an oil leak on the passanger side of the engine around the sump/cam area underneath...the oil never leaks when the car is parked only when running, and when above idle...when I top up my oil to the F mark on the oil stick within 200-300 miles the oil level is at E or the bottom of the oil stick....The oil never seems to go lower than this mark. When I top up the oil again it only takes 1/2 litre to get back to the F mark again.































Anyone every some across this?















I know its not ideal to run the engine without optimum oil level but will this actually damage the engine running like this?

First, check the oil plug and filter first to make sure that they are tight and not cross threaded, if you say that it only leaks when the car is running hints to maybe a cracked hose or a lose bolt because its being forced out, take off the oil pan and check the gasket, chances are that if the plug, filter, and hoses are ok, then its the oil pan gasket.
